How many terms are in the expression 6w- 3x+9y- 8z+ 12​

Answer:

5

Step-by-step explanation:

Definition of term:

        A term is a single mathematical expression. It may be a single number (positive or negative), a single variable ( a letter ), several variables multiplied but never added or subtracted.

                 6w- 3x+9y- 8z+ 12​

                                   \/

6w          - 3x        +9y          - 8z          + 12​
